Origins and Evolution



Freetown Christiania started in 1971 when a bunch of squatters, artists, activists, and homeless men and women broke into an deserted armed service foundation during the Christianshavn district of Copenhagen. The barracks had stood empty For a long time, along with the team noticed a chance to reclaim the Room for community use. What commenced being a protest from housing shortages promptly turned into a bold social experiment: to produce a self-ruled Group designed on values like flexibility, cooperation, and shared possession.

The founders of Christiania declared the realm open and independent from Danish law. They arrange their very own policies, determined by collective determination-producing as well as a deep respect for individual liberty. After some time, Christiania formulated into a living illustration of counterculture—rejecting materialism, promoting ecological dwelling, and encouraging creativeness in all types. Houses were being generally created by hand making use of recycled supplies, as well as community became recognized for its colorful murals, handmade buildings, and a powerful sense of Local community.

Christiania’s early a long time were marked by idealism and experimentation. People developed shared spaces for cooking, education and learning, youngster treatment, and cultural things to do. They ran communal corporations, like bicycle workshops and cafés, and hosted concerts, exhibitions, and political situations.

Even with frequent conflicts Using the Danish governing administration—primarily more than land use plus the open sale of cannabis—the Group survived several eviction threats. Each time, Christianites defended their suitable to Reside in another way and negotiate their spot in Modern society.

By 2012, the Danish state authorized Christiania’s residents to legally order the land by way of a Basis, giving them additional balance though preserving their special Way of living. Even though not without the need of difficulties, this marked A serious turning point—from a squat to your legally acknowledged, self-managed community that still operates based on the spirit of its primary vision.

Christiania stays amongst Europe’s most well-known social experiments in autonomy and different dwelling.

Cultural Significance



Christiania is not only a community—it’s a image of liberty, nonconformity, and creative dwelling. From the start, culture has become at the guts of Christiania’s id. The community swiftly grew to become a magnet for artists, musicians, writers, and no cost-thinkers who were drawn to its open-minded spirit and rejection of classic norms.

The world is noted for its bold Road art, colourful properties, and handmade architecture. Approximately every wall is covered in murals, some political, Other individuals basically expressive. Properties are comprised of recycled materials, shaped by their creators with out worry for uniformity. This patchwork of kinds demonstrates the range and creative imagination of your people who live there.

Christiania can also be a Middle for songs and efficiency. The neighborhood hosts typical live shows, In particular at venues like Loppen and also the Grey Hall. These stages have welcomed local and international artists throughout genres—punk, reggae, rock, and Digital. Tunes is a component of everyday life in Christiania, typically spilling out in the streets.

Art galleries, studios, and workshops also thrive in Christiania. People and people can discover ceramics, sculptures, paintings, and crafts staying manufactured and marketed by neighborhood artists. The Neighborhood supports artistic freedom and sees creative imagination as important to particular and social expansion.

Foodstuff and sustainability will also be Element of Christiania’s cultural material. The neighborhood contains vegetarian cafés, organic bakeries, and inexperienced spaces used for gardening. This reflects a broader benefit process centered on ecological consciousness and self-sufficiency.

Christiania’s cultural influence goes beyond Copenhagen. It's got influenced documentaries, guides, and educational research. Tourists from throughout the world take a look at not only to determine its uniqueness, but to working experience a unique method of life—one which values freedom, cooperation, and creativeness over gain or Conference.

By way of art, tunes, and everyday dwelling, Christiania displays that culture might be each a sort of resistance along with a technique for creating Group.

Problems and Reforms



Christiania’s record is not simply certainly one of creativeness and freedom—it's also confronted severe issues. Essentially the most persistent challenges have revolved across the sale of cannabis on “Pusher Avenue,” an open up-air industry that operated for many years despite currently being unlawful beneath Danish regulation.

Whilst a lot of people tolerated the cannabis trade as A part of Christiania’s cost-free-spirited id, it more and more attracted arranged criminal offense and gang exercise. As time passes, what started as smaller-scale sales changed into a perilous and violent company. Incidents of intimidation, assault, and in some cases shootings turned extra typical, drawing nationwide consideration and force from law enforcement and politicians.

This example created tension inside the Neighborhood. A lot of Christianites planned to maintain their community’s security and ideals, However they lacked the equipment and authority to cope with the felony aspects that experienced taken root. The cannabis trade, the moment viewed being an act of defiance, started to threaten Christiania’s individual values of peace and cooperation.

In 2024, just after decades of growing issue, the Group took An important move. Christiania’s residents collectively decided to dismantle the physical buildings of Pusher Avenue, taking away the cannabis stalls in order to split the cycle of violence and reclaim their community spaces. This was not a call designed flippantly—it mirrored deep discussions along with a shift in priorities.

The removing of Pusher Avenue marked An important reform. It confirmed that Christiania was ready to evolve and confront inner issues whilst staying legitimate to its Main ideas. Alongside this effort, there have also been talks about expanding cooperation with town officials on safety, housing, and infrastructure—without supplying up self-rule.

These reforms spotlight a more experienced phase in Christiania’s enhancement. The Local community remains dedicated to autonomy and choice residing, but having a clearer focus on shielding its citizens and ensuring its upcoming as a safe, Inventive, and inclusive put.



Authorized Status and Long run Prospective clients



For Significantly of its background, Christiania existed in a authorized gray place. The land it occupied was owned from the Danish governing administration, along with the residents experienced no formal legal rights to it. This led to a long time of tension, authorized battles, and threats of eviction. Yet Christiania persisted, with assist from each the general public and political figures who saw worth in its option product.

A major turning place came in 2012. Soon after years of negotiation, Christiania’s inhabitants fashioned the Foundation Freetown Christiania and entered into an arrangement with the Danish condition. They were being allowed to acquire the land they lived on, transitioning from squatters to legal landowners. This gave Christiania a lot more steadiness and a chance to protect its strategy for lifestyle By itself terms.

Possessing the land gave the Local community more Handle, but In addition it came with new duties. The inspiration has become accountable for controlling the residence, maintaining infrastructure, and having to pay taxes. Christiania stays self-ruled, applying consensus-primarily based determination-building, but it also needs to equilibrium its beliefs with lawful and monetary obligations.

Seeking forward, Christiania faces both equally alternatives and challenges. 1 essential challenge is housing. There are actually plans to introduce much more public housing and make the realm a lot more available although preserving its exclusive character. This raises questions on the way to improve devoid of losing the values which make Christiania special.

There is also ongoing work to further improve protection, Primarily once the dismantling of Pusher Avenue. Inhabitants are collaborating far more with metropolis authorities although insisting on retaining their autonomy.

Regardless of past conflicts, Christiania has revealed it may possibly adapt. Its upcoming probable will depend on obtaining that stability—guarding its freedom and creativity while check here cooperating where by wanted. It stays a uncommon experiment in self-rule, offering a robust example of how a community can evolve without offering up its soul.
